Cloudbreak 2.7.2 images does not exist?

avatar
Explorer

I am using Cloudbreak 2.7.2 on openstack deployment with doc here: https://docs.hortonworks.com/HDPDocuments/Cloudbreak/Cloudbreak-2.7.2/content/os-launch/index.html

Failed on 'Launching Cloudbreak on OpenStack' -> 'cbd pull-parallel' step.The fail reason is the installation can not find the docker images.

I checked the docker-compose.yml and found that there are many images using the tag:2.7.2. But these tags images can not be found in the hortonworks repo at dockerhub(e.g. https://hub.docker.com/r/hortonworks/cloudbreak/tags/).

So i am really confused. Can anyone help?

Hi @Tianyi Chen!

Could you check which images were not accessible from the generated docker-compose.yml?

Dockerhub shows only the last created/updated images in tags (https://github.com/docker/hub-feedback/issues/1416) but when I execute this:

docker pull hortonworks/cloudbreak:2.7.2

then docker pulls it successfully, so it exists.
